软考,即计算机软件专业技术资格(水平)考试,是我国在计算机技术与软件专业领域内的一项重要考试。它不仅是对从业人员技术水平的一种衡量,更是促进软件行业规范化、标准化发展的关键一环。那么,针对这样的专业考试,到底有什么样的专业要求呢?

首先,从基础知识层面来看,软考对其参考人员提出了相对明确的专业要求。无论是初级、中级还是高级的软考,都要求考生掌握相应领域内的基本理论和核心知识。例如,在软件设计师的考试中,就需要考生对数据结构、操作系统、软件工程等基础理论知识有深入的理解和应用能力。而对于更高级别的系统分析师考试,则进一步要求考生具备系统架构设计、需求分析和系统测试等更加复杂的专业知识。

其次,在技能应用方面,软考的专业要求也十分严格。软考不仅要求考生能够理解和掌握理论知识,更重要的是要能够将这些理论知识应用到实际的问题解决中去。在考试中,这一点通常通过案例分析、设计文档编写、代码编写等形式来考察。这意味着,仅仅靠死记硬背是无法通过软考的,考生必须真正理解和掌握相关知识和技能,并能够灵活运用。

此外,软考还对考生的项目管理能力提出了一定的要求。特别是在中高级别的软考中,项目管理知识域通常是一个重要的考试内容。考生需要了解项目管理的基本概念、流程和方法,并能够结合实际情况进行有效的项目规划和执行。这一点对于培养软件行业内的复合型人才具有重要意义,因为一个优秀的软件工程师不仅需要能够编写高质量的代码,还需要具备一定的项目管理能力,以确保项目的顺利进行。

再次,软考对考生的综合素质也有着不低的要求。这包括考生的分析问题能力、解决问题能力、创新思维能力以及沟通协调能力等。在软考的各级别考试中,都会通过设置具有一定难度和复杂性的实际问题来考察考生的这些能力。例如,在系统架构设计师考试中,就可能会要求考生针对一个给定的系统需求进行分析和设计,这就需要考生能够综合运用所学知识和技能,进行有效的创新思维和分析问题。

最后,值得一提的是,虽然软考对其参考人员提出了诸多专业要求,但这并不意味着只有计算机专业背景的人才能够参加软考。实际上,软考的报名门槛相对较低,任何对计算机技术感兴趣并愿意为之付出努力的人都可以尝试参加。当然,由于软考的专业性和实用性,想要通过考试并获得相应资格证书,还是需要付出一定的努力和时间来进行系统学习和准备的。

综上所述,软考的专业要求涵盖了理论知识、技能应用、项目管理能力以及综合素质等多个方面。它不仅是对软件从业人员专业水平的一种全面检验,更是推动我国软件行业健康、快速发展的重要手段之一。对于广大软件从业人员而言,通过参加软考并不断提升自己的专业能力和综合素质,将有助于在激烈的职场竞争中脱颖而出,实现个人价值和职业发展的双重飞跃。